**Ticket SRCH-214: Relevance tuning notes — boost weights changed**

Plugin authors, please note: we lowered the title-match boost in Lanternquery from 3.2 to 2.1 and added a recency decay. Custom scorers extending `RankHook` should re-run their fixtures, as ordering may shift. Full tuning notes are versioned under the build token below.

build token for bahip-fawif: htk3_6a1

When a customer reports the Harrowfield import wizard stuck at the validation step, first check the file size — anything over 200k rows routes to the async validator, which can take several minutes and shows no progress bar (known limitation, fix planned). If it's stuck beyond ten minutes, the usual cause is a malformed header row with trailing delimiters; the validator loops silently. Ask the customer for the first five lines of the file before escalating. The full triage flowchart and escalation criteria are on the internal support page.

dashboard of bafof-hafog = https://confluence.lumiclabs.internal/display/browse/display/6a09a20a

Onboarding note for releases of Ladleworks, our recipe-scaling calculator. Release builds pull unit-conversion tables from the internal Measures service at package time, so the build box needs network access to it. Before tagging, double-check the version bump in both manifest files. Then, in the release runner's environment file, insert the following credential line so the fetch succeeds:

env line for fafof-fahag: LEDGER_TOKEN5=f8790

# Trellick dispatch handlers — cold start notes for on-call.
# Cold starts spike when the Fenwick pool scales from zero; first invocation
# pays for config fetch plus connection warmup (~1.8s). Do not "fix" this by
# pinning min instances without clearing it with capacity planning.
# Mitigation: the warm ping cron keeps two handlers hot in the Verdane region.
# If latency alarms fire anyway, check the token cache first; an expired token
# forces a full re-auth on every start. The handler reads its credential from the line below.

secret setting of tawif-tajop: COURIER_KEY13=819c65d82d2bd